Zara vs Zarek

American parents have registered 20,930 Zaras since 1880, against 1,113 Zareks. Zara is still ahead, with 1,432 babies in 2025.

Who was ahead

Zara has been the commoner name in every year either was published, 1896 to 2025. The lead has never changed hands.

The closest they came was 1999, when Zara had 111 and Zarek had 52.

Which name is older

Half of the Zareks alive today are over 16; half the Zaras are over 7. That is 9 years between them: two names in use at the same time, worn by two different generations.
